/*
arqinator: arq/pack.go
Implements functions common to pack files (both trees and blobs, both .index and .pack files).

package arq
import (
"crypto/sha1"
"crypto/subtle"
"errors"
"fmt"
"io"
"os"
log "github.com/Sirupsen/logrus"
)
/**
Verify that a pack file is valid. All pack files end with a 20-byte SHA1 of the full contents of the file.
*/
func IsValidPackFile(cacheFilepath string) (bool, error) {
fileInfo, err := os.Stat(cacheFilepath)
if err != nil {
// some error whilst reading the file from the file system.
log.Debugln("IsValidPackFile: some error while stat-ing file: ", err)
return false, err
}
size := fileInfo.Size()
if (size <= 20) {
// the file itself is <= 20 bytes big, so the file must be truncated
msg := fmt.Sprintf("IsValidPackFile: file is too small, must be truncated. size: %s", fileInfo.Size())
log.Debugln(msg)
return false, errors.New(msg)
}
f, err := os.Open(cacheFilepath)
if err != nil {
log.Debugln("IsValidPackFile: some error while opening file: ", err)
return false, err
}
defer f.Close()
hasher := sha1.New()
if _, err := io.CopyN(hasher, f, size - 20); err != nil {
log.Debugln("IsValidPackFile: error whilst reading pack file: ", err)
return false, err
}
calculatedHash := hasher.Sum(nil)
expectedHash := make([]byte, 20)
if _, err := io.ReadAtLeast(f, expectedHash, 20); err != nil {
log.Debugln("IsValidPackFile: error whilst reading last 20 bytes of file: ", err)
return false, err
}
result := subtle.ConstantTimeCompare(calculatedHash, expectedHash) == 1
if !result {
return false, errors.New("IsValidPackFile hash checksum does not match file contents")
}
return true, nil
}
